About Bingwen Hu
Bingwen Hu is a scholar working on Spectroscopy, Nuclear and High Energy Physics and Materials Chemistry, having authored 10 papers that have together received 318 indexed citations. Recurring topics across this work include Advanced NMR Techniques and Applications (10 papers), NMR spectroscopy and applications (7 papers) and Solid-state spectroscopy and crystallography (7 papers). The work is most often cited by research in Spectroscopy (287 citations), Nuclear and High Energy Physics (144 citations) and Biophysics (32 citations). Bingwen Hu has collaborated with scholars based in France, China and United States. Frequent co-authors include Jean‐Paul Amoureux, Julien Trébosc, S. Hafner, Olivier Lafon, Laurent Delevoye, Grégory Tricot, Michaël Deschamps, Feng Deng, Qiang Wang and Christophe Legein. Their work appears in journals such as The Journal of Chemical Physics, Chemical Communications and Physical Chemistry Chemical Physics.
